@import url("https://fonts.googleapis.com/css2?family=Roboto&family=Roboto+Condensed");.uabb-offcanvas-text .familymenu span {
  font-family: Roboto;
  font-weight: 600;
  text-transform: uppercase;
  font-size: 13px;
  line-height: 5px;
}
.uabb-offcanvas-text .familymenu > a {
  padding-top: 8px !important;
  padding-bottom: 8px !important;
}
.uabb-offcanvas-content .acefamily > a {
  padding-top: 35px !important;
  padding-right: 10px;
  padding-left: 0px !important;
  margin-left: 10px;
  margin-bottom: 15px;
  text-transform: uppercase;
  line-height: 5px;
  border-bottom-color: #ffffff;
  border-bottom-width: 2px;
  border-bottom-style: solid;
}
.uabb-offcanvas-text .tertiarymenu > a {
  padding-top: 8px !important;
  padding-bottom: 8px !important;
}
.uabb-offcanvas-text .tertiarymenu span {
  font-family: Roboto;
  font-weight: 600;
  font-size: 13px;
  line-height: 5px;
}
.uabb-offcanvas-content .uabb-active > .sub-menu {
  background-color: #ffffff;
  padding-top: 7px;
  padding-bottom: 7px;
}
.uabb-offcanvas-menu > .uabb-active .menu-item > a {
  color: #b3282d;
}
.uabb-active .menu-item span {
  color: #b3282d;
}
/*--Camping Rates Table--*/
/*--Table14--*/
.dataTables_scrollBody > #tablepress-14 .row-2 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
  font-size: 16px;
}
.dataTables_scrollBody > #tablepress-14 .row-6 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
  font-size: 16px;
}
#tablepress-14_wrapper > #tablepress-14 .row-2 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
  font-size: 16px;
}
#tablepress-14_wrapper > #tablepress-14 .row-6 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
}
#tablepress-14 td.column-1 {
  width: 40%;
}
#tablepress-14 td.column-2 {
  font-size: 14px;
}
#tablepress-14 td.column-3 {
  font-weight: 600;
  text-align: right;
}
/*--Table15--*/
.dataTables_scrollBody > #tablepress-15 .row-2 > td {
  background-color: #2350af;
  color: #ffffff;
  font-weight: 600;
}
.dataTables_scrollBody > #tablepress-15 .row-7 > td {
  background-color: #2350af;
  color: #ffffff;
  font-weight: 600;
}
.dataTables_scrollBody > #tablepress-15 .row-12 > td {
  background-color: #2350af;
  color: #ffffff;
  font-weight: 600;
}
.dataTables_scrollBody > #tablepress-15 .row-19 > td {
  background-color: #2350af;
  color: #ffffff;
  font-weight: 600;
}
.dataTables_scrollBody > #tablepress-15 td.column-3 {
  width: 40%;
}
.dataTables_scrollBody > #tablepress-15 td.column-3 {
  font-weight: 600;
  text-align: right;
}
#tablepress-15_wrapper > #tablepress-15 .row-2 > td {
  background-color: #2350af;
  color: #ffffff;
  font-weight: 600;
}
#tablepress-15_wrapper > #tablepress-15 .row-7 > td {
  background-color: #2350af;
  color: #ffffff;
  font-weight: 600;
}
#tablepress-15_wrapper > #tablepress-15 .row-12 > td {
  background-color: #2350af;
  color: #ffffff;
  font-weight: 600;
}
#tablepress-15_wrapper > #tablepress-15 .row-19 > td {
  background-color: #2350af;
  color: #ffffff;
  font-weight: 600;
}
#tablepress-15 td.column-3 {
  font-weight: 600;
}
/*--Table27--*/
.dataTables_scrollBody > #tablepress-27 .row-2 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
  font-size: 16px;
}
.dataTables_scrollBody > #tablepress-27 .row-6 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
  font-size: 16px;
}
.dataTables_scrollBody > #tablepress-27 .row-9 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
  font-size: 16px;
}
#tablepress-27_wrapper > #tablepress-27 .row-2 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
  font-size: 16px;
}
#tablepress-27_wrapper > #tablepress-27 .row-6 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
}
#tablepress-27_wrapper > #tablepress-27 .row-9 > td {
  background-color: #2350af;
  font-weight: 600;
  color: #ffffff;
}
#tablepress-27 td.column-1 {
  width: 40%;
}
#tablepress-27 td.column-2 {
  font-size: 14px;
}
#tablepress-27 td.column-3 {
  font-weight: 600;
  text-align: right;
}
.maindate {
  color: #ffffff;
  font-size: 14px;
  font-weight: 600;
  font-family: Roboto Condensed;
  text-transform: uppercase;
}
.news-scroll .uabb-blog-posts .uabb-blog-post-content .uabb-button-wrap {
  margin-top: 16px;
}
.uabb-post-wrapper .uabb-blog-posts-description {
  padding-top: 9px;
}
/*---Tables Mobile-----*/
@media only screen and (max-width: 600px) {
  .dataTables_scrollBody > #tablepress-14 td.column-1 {
    width: 30%;
  }
  .dataTables_scrollBody > #tablepress-15 td.column-3 {
    width: 30%;
  }
  #tablepress-27 td.column-1 {
    width: 30%;
  }
}
